The Concept of Predictive Maintenance in Home Services

Predictive maintenance refers to the use of data-driven, proactive maintenance strategies that predict and prevent equipment failures before they occur. In the context of home services, this means utilizing AI to analyze data from various sources such as sensors and usage patterns to anticipate potential problems in household systems like HVAC, plumbing, or electrical circuits. This approach not only prevents inconvenient breakdowns but also extends the lifespan of home appliances and systems, ensuring cost savings for homeowners.

Market Insights & Data-Backed Analysis

According to a report by MarketsandMarkets, the global predictive maintenance market size is expected to grow from USD 4.0 billion in 2020 to USD 12.3 billion by 2025, at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 25.2% during the forecast period. The adoption of predictive maintenance techniques in home services could significantly reduce repair costs by up to 30%, demonstrating not just enhanced service reliability but also substantial economic benefits.

Challenges and Opportunities

While predictive maintenance presents numerous advantages, its implementation comes with challenges such as high initial setup costs and the need for continuous data analysis capabilities. However, these challenges present opportunities for innovative companies like Wolly to develop more accessible and scalable solutions that could democratize advanced PropTech applications for average homeowners.
